How should the North American continent be divided now that the war is over?

History
1 answer:
Stells [14]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Anyway, the 1763 Treaty came at the end of the Seven Years War (or French & Indian War in North America). The French ended up losing all of their holdings in North America, divided along the Mississippi River. ... Britain intended for this to limit the westward expansion of their colonists to preserve an Indian State.

To which art form did Cicero contribute in ancient Rome?
8090 [49]
Cicero was a very famous philosopher and orator during the time period of Ancient Rome. He was known for adding both rhetoric and oratory to the studies of the language and had a large influence in prose and the current language during that time period, Latin.
